I survived the Pacfic Crest Half Marathon. Here are the Results. I finished in 1:36:21. I ran at around 7:15 pace until around mile 10 where I hit the wall ... hard :). I faded to about 8:12 for the last mile. Picture: Use bib number 4716.

Warning: Complaining Follows
Why I hit the wall:

  • I did not fuel and hydrate well for the conditions
  • It was 75+ degrees and rising by the 10 mile mark
  • Sunriver has 4200 feet of elevation
  • The course is fairly hilly.
  • When I and 500+ others were told it was time to walk to the start line we were surprised to find 500+ more people already there and the race organizer was counting down 10,9,8...
    I had to weave my way through 450 people to get to others running the same pace.
  • Or it could be I was overly ambitious

This was the first competitive half marathon I have ever done. The only other attempt was when I was 17 and I thought I could just show up on race day and run it. Suffice it to say I walked half of that race.

So, for my first Half Marathon I got 37th place out of 1100+ people. I feel pretty good about that. Of course, all of this is in preparation for the Portland Marathon. I was going to use this race as a guide for pacing the marathon. However, due to the factors complained about above I don't think it is accurate. So the next step is the Lacamas Lake Half Marathon. The conditions should be a bit better there. If I tank again, then I know I need to reset my goals.
